New update :
An alternative solution is to add \usepackage{underscore} just
before\begin{document}
(instead of changing the catcode or loading the hyperref package).
But for the doi, at least with the elsearticle-num bibliography style, the
underscore displayed is narrower than the real underscore _, it's more like a
̲ (and when copied from the TeX Preview, it's only a space).
Perhaps it's a better solution (despite the narrow _ and that it becomes a
space when copied).
I hope all the suggestions here and in the previous mail can help other users,
and perhaps the BibDesk authors can modify the file ~/Library/Application
Support/BibDesk/previewtemplate.tex with one of the suggestions.
For the narrow _, it's perhaps only a bug in elsarticle-num and other
bibliography styles which displays the doi field have not this bug.
